As of 2026, Karyopharm Therapeutics Inc. generates $146.07 million in annual revenue (growing 11.6% year-over-year), with a 9.9% gross margin and -52.4% operating margin. Market capitalization stands at $161.79 million. Here is how the company generates its revenue:
Karyopharm generates revenue through product sales, collaborations, and licensing agreements related to its drug candidates and technology.
